NFL QB Drafts - Art or Science? So Many Variables


May 15, 2022, 10:33 PM

Just taking a look at last seven NFL drafts. Read some pre-draft fluff from so-called SME's about 2018 draft being outstanding with Darnold and Rosen having high upsides. Also read 2017 QB class was considered weak (L. Zierlein, NFL; Kiper, ESPN).

Not sold on most of NFL teams or media having competent QB evaluation capability ... any thoughts on recent drafts?

2016 - Goff #1 / Wentz #2 / Paxton Lynch #26 / 4 other QB's / Prescott #135

2017 - Trubisky #2 / Mahomes #10 / Watson #12 / media reported poor QB class

2018 - Mayfield #1 / Darnold #3 / Allen #7 / Rosen #10 / Jackson #32

2019 - Murray #1 / Jones #6 / Haskins #15 / Lock #42

2020 - Burrow #1 / Tagavaiola #5 / Herbert #6 / Love #26 / Hurts #53 / Eason #122

2021 - TL16 #1 / Wilson #2 / Lance #3 / Fields #11 / Jones #15 / Trask #64 / Mond #66 / Mills #67

2022 - Pickett #20 / Ridder #74 / Willis #86 / Corral #94

Traditionally speaking, I'd say situational vs Art or Science.

If a 1st round pick ends up at a dysfunctional organization (Jags, Jets, Lions), you're going to see more bust potential vs someone ending up with a functional place (Steelers, Chiefs, GB).

I've only seen a couple times recently where a QB ended up in a place where success has been hard to find and they still hit their all star potential (DW4 - HOU, Herbert - Chargers, Allen - Bills)

Usually, you need a good combination of Ownership/Organization + HC to compete for SBs.

I'm glad TL16 got a fresh start with Doug Peterson because who knows how he would've turned out with Meyer.

I know some folks weren't big on him but I think the Jags got a potentially good pick up with him -- I get a vibe they'll gel wayyyy better together than Meyer + TL
